About Swift Creek Elementary

Set in Raleigh, North Carolina, Swift Creek Elementary is a modestly sized K-5 school, operated by Wake County Schools. It caters to 310 students across grades K through 5. Compared to the state average of about 467 students per school, that is 34% smaller than typical.

Wake County Schools runs 198 schools in total, collectively educating 163,176 students. Swift Creek Elementary is one of those campuses.

In terms of who attends, Swift Creek Elementary lists that the largest single group is White at 48%, but no single group is in the majority; the rest breaks down as 24% Hispanic, 17% Black, 6% multiracial, 5% Asian. That is noticeably less White than the county at large, where the share is closer to 58%.

Looking at the economic backdrop, On paper, Swift Creek Elementary has 25 full-time-equivalent teachers, translating to a class-load average of around 12.5:1. That figure is tighter than the state norm's 14.9:1 average. Around 44% of the student body qualifies for free or reduced-price meals, a commonly cited indicator of low-income enrollment.

On a residual basis (actual vs predicted given the student mix), Swift Creek Elementary performs roughly as the BeatsExpectations model predicts for a school with this FRL share. The predicted value is around 65.3%, the actual is 66.9%, a residual of +1.6 points.

Around the school, the surrounding county (Wake County) shows that the typical household earns roughly $105,768 per year, roughly 57%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and roughly 5% of residents live below the federal poverty line. Swift Creek Elementary is one of 237 public schools in Wake County (combined enrollment of about 184,790 students).

Nearest neighbor: Garner High, around 0.2 miles off.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ools. On composite proficiency, Swift Creek Elementary comes 1st of 7 in the immediate cluster, higher than the nearby-schools average of 46.4%.

Swift Creek Elementary operates from an outer-ring location.

Trend over the last 7 years. Over the past 7-year window, the student count ticked down 29%: 438 students in 2018 compared to 310 in 2025. Black enrollment moved from 27% to 17% across the same window. The student-to-teacher ratio fell from 14.4:1 in 2018 to 12.5:1 today.
